  • OroraTech is the global leader in space-based thermal intelligence. Our proprietary satellite technology and advanced data platform provide actionable insights for wildfire detection, monitoring, and response. Headquartered in Munich, Germany, OroraTech is expanding its footprint in North America through OroraTech USA Inc., with a focus on supporting public agencies, utilities, and critical infrastructure providers in fire-prone regions.
    Youll be part of a growing U.S. team, playing a key role in our Denver-based presence while collaborating with a highly international and mission-driven organization. Our U.S. strategy is centered on building strong local relationships, scaling government and enterprise partnerships, and driving adoption of our wildfire intelligence platform across North America.
